有時(shí)候不同的軟件要和不同的jdk配合使用有序,所以可能一臺機(jī)器上會需要安裝多個(gè)JDK版本
第一步:
vi ~/.bash_profile
# 設(shè)置 jdk1.6
export JAVA_6_HOME=`/usr/libexec/java_home -v 1.6`
# 設(shè)置 jdk1.7
export JAVA_7_HOME=`/usr/libexec/java_home -v 1.7`
# 設(shè)置 jdk1.8
export JAVA_8_HOME=`/usr/libexec/java_home -v 1.8`
# 默認(rèn) jdk 使用1.6版本
export JAVA_HOME=$JAVA_6_HOME
# alias 命令動態(tài)切換 jdk 版本
alias jdk6="export JAVA_HOME=$JAVA_6_HOME"
alias jdk7="export JAVA_HOME=$JAVA_7_HOME"
alias jdk8="export JAVA_HOME=$JAVA_8_HOME"
第二步:
執(zhí)行:alias jdk6
source ~/.bash_profile // 刷新環(huán)境變量
第三步:
java -version // 查看當(dāng)前的 jdk 版